About Shinji MAKINO, Ph.D.

(1942-2012)
Developer of π-water and its systems

Born in Aichi prefecture, Japan, Doctor Makino graduated from the Science Department of Tohoku University. He attained his doctorate from the Graduate School of Nagoya University. In 1975, after working at a pharmaceutical company for a time, he founded IBE, a limited company, aimed at developing and applying the π-water system. Since then he has been active in π-water research and its applications in health and fitness, biotechnology, agriculture, engineering, and fisheries.

In 1995 the Association for Research and Propagation of Bio Energy Systems was established and he was installed as the Chief Director.

How π water was discovered

| πwater was discovered during the study of physiology of plants. In 1964 in Japan the late professor Yoshiaki Goto and Dr. Shoji Yamashita of agricultural department of Nagoya University noticed the living water contained in plants is the very important factor in flower bud differentiation during their study of it.

Dr. Yamashita tentatively named the water, "the water that is very similar to living water," as "πwater." Afterward it was explicated that π-water plays an important role not only in flower bud differentiation but also in healthy growing of plants and animals.
